A fade is supposed to push the WR to the boundary to increase separation. Brennan’s throw was where it was supposed to be. Johnson’s would have been a pb at best.

Incorrect, he faded it to the boundary. WR breaks 5 yards from a sprint to get under it while the DB would still be on his heels. If the WR can make that grab it’s a nearly indefensible throw.

It’s one throw, but it is an excellent one.
